Roof flashing installation services involve the placement of specialized materials around roof features such as chimneys, vents, skylights, and roof valleys. These metal or flexible materials are designed to create a watertight barrier that directs water away from vulnerable areas of the roof. Proper installation of roof flashing is essential to prevent leaks and water intrusion, especially in areas where the roof intersects with other structures or penetrates the roof surface. Skilled contractors assess the specific needs of each property and ensure that flashing is correctly positioned and sealed to provide long-lasting protection against water damage.
This service helps address common roofing problems related to water infiltration, which can lead to mold growth, wood rot, and structural deterioration if left unresolved. Over time, flashing can become damaged, corroded, or improperly installed, compromising its effectiveness. Installing new or replacement flashing can rectify these issues, enhancing the roof’s ability to shed water and protecting the underlying roof deck and interior spaces. Regular maintenance and timely repairs of flashing are critical to maintaining the overall integrity of the roofing system.

Material Costs - The cost of roof flashing materials typically ranges from $5 to $15 per linear foot, depending on the type used, such as aluminum or copper. Higher-end materials like copper can significantly increase overall expenses.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ific project needs.
Labor Expenses - Installation labor for roof flashing generally costs between $45 and $75 per hour, with total project costs varying based on roof size and complexity. Some projects may take multiple hours, affecting the overall price. Contact local service providers for detailed quotes.
Project Size & Scope - Small repairs or upgrades might cost around $200 to $500, while full-scale flashing replacements on larger roofs can range from $1,000 to $3,000 or more. The extent of work influences the final cost significantly. Local pros can assess the specific requirements to offer accurate pricing.
Additional Costs - Extra expenses may include removal of old flashing, roof penetrations, or complex roof configurations, adding $100 to $500 or more. These factors can impact the overall cost depending on the project's specifics. Contact local contractors for detailed cost assessments.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is roof flashing installation? Roof flashing installation involves adding or replacing metal strips around roof features to prevent water intrusion and protect the structure.
Why is proper flashing important? Proper flashing helps direct water away from vulnerable areas, reducing the risk of leaks and water damage to the roof and interior.
How long does roof flashing installation typically take? The duration varies depending on the roof's size and complexity but generally takes a few hours to complete.
What materials are used for roof flashing? Common materials include aluminum, copper, galvanized steel, and lead, chosen for durability and compatibility with roofing materials.
